AS9329 (SLTINT-AS-AP) is the Internet-services AS of Sri Lanka Telecom, the country's incumbent fixed-line operator (marketed today alongside its mobile arm as SLT-Mobitel). It is the network most Sri Lankan fixed broadband subscribers sit behind.

What it's used for

This is an eyeball access network, and the routing shape says so plainly. RIS observes 146 IPv4 prefixes carrying about 264,448 addresses and 10 IPv6 prefixes, against only 12 BGP neighbours. A quarter of a million addresses with barely a dozen neighbours is the signature of an access network serving its own subscribers: the traffic terminates on customers, not on other people's networks, so there is no reason to accumulate the hundreds of adjacencies a wholesale carrier would show. The inventory is consistent with a national incumbent that received large contiguous allocations rather than scraping together scattered blocks: a 124.43.0.0/16, several /18s (203.94.64.0/18, 222.165.128.0/18, 220.247.192.0/18, 203.115.0.0/18) and a dense run of /19s out of 112.135.0.0. IPv6 is deployed out of 2402:d000::/32, carved into /40s, which is how a broadband operator hands space to regional aggregation. Sampled reverse DNS returns v4.dns.slt.lk on several addresses, confirming SLT's own resolver infrastructure lives inside the space.

Notable

  • Sri Lanka Telecom is the incumbent telco; this AS carries its consumer and business Internet access, not a separate transit product.
  • The slt.lk PTRs are operator infrastructure (recursive DNS), which is a useful positive confirmation that the holder actually operates the space.
  • IPv6 is real here, not token: a full /32 broken into multiple routed /40s.
